OpenWay Gets the Highest Possible Rating from Leading Analyst Firm

OpenWay, the global vendor of the WAY4 payment processing software, is rated as strong positive by Gartner, the world leader in IT research and consulting. 13 vendors were evaluated for the 2009 report “MarketScope for Multiregional Card Management Software”. OpenWay received the highest possible rating of Strong Positive. According to Gartner’s scale, “strong positive” means that potential customers may “consider this vendor a strong choice for strategic investments”.

To be included in the Gartner’s report “MarketScope for Multiregional Card Management Software”, a vendor had to have at least 30 production customers in 2 or more main world regions. The software had to support major card programs, account types, issuing and acquiring functionalities. Gartner evaluated vendors based on geographic and offering strategy, product quality, customer experience, innovation and other criteria. Customers were interviewed by Gartner as part of the Gartner research methodology.
